Transaction 2ef945aaf290e59212195865f19e0783a441ff93dbc51069d5a06a5752026ea4
1 Input
2 Outputs
- 2ef945aaf290e59212195865f19e0783a441ff93dbc51069d5a06a5752026ea4:0
- 2ef945aaf290e59212195865f19e0783a441ff93dbc51069d5a06a5752026ea4:1
value 1271185
address 3EVyMZUCTmzoWmWbLQ6ume47ZXHM4KJ68X
value 29205701
address 1QCJDDkzgTKaznGpGP7zu3kVDt3DoAw78z